FOX Announces More Stars for 'Idol Gives Back'
Thursday, March 27, 2008
             
American Idol is gearing up for the second annual Idol Gives Back charity extravaganza.  The two and a half hour event (which will air Wednesday, April 9, starting at 7:30pm ET/PT) is going to be an excessively star-studded affair, featuring celebrities from all areas of popular culture.  Today, FOX revealed a list of recent additions to this year's Idol Gives Back and the names are actually quite impressive.  Included are former American Idol contestants Elliott Yamin and Fantasia Barrino, and High School Musical actresses Vanessa Hudgens and Ashley Tisdale.  They join already announced names such as Bono, Brad Pitt and Hannah Montana star Miley Cyrus.

In addition to Fantasia, Yamin and the two High School Musical actresses, comedians Robin Williams, Billy Crystal and Dane Cook will be there, as will actors Jennifer Connelly, 24's Kiefer Sutherland, Forest Whitaker, and Amy Adams.  Also making an appearance, for the second year in a row, will be singer Celine Dion.  I'm guessing she won't be doing another duet with Elvis.  An impressive list, to be sure.
